Can I Get A UAE E Visa On Arrival As A Turkey Citizen?
No. Turkish citizens are not eligible for a UAE eVisa on arrival. If you hold a Turkish passport and require a visa to enter the United Arab Emirates, you must obtain the appropriate UAE eVisa before traveling. Arriving without an approved visa may result in being denied boarding or entry.
Apply for your UAE eVisa online
The UAE eVisa application process is completed online, making it convenient for travelers to apply before departure. Before starting your application, ensure your passport is valid for at least six months from your intended date of entry into the UAE.
When completing the online application, you will typically need to provide:
- Personal information
- Passport details
- Travel dates and itinerary
- Contact information
Make sure all information matches your passport to help avoid processing delays.
Choose the right visa type
Depending on the purpose and duration of your trip, you can apply for one of several UAE visa options, including:
- Tourist Visa – 30-day single entry
- Tourist Visa – 60-day single entry
- Tourist Visa – 90-day single entry
- Tourist Visa – 30-day multiple entry
- Tourist Visa – 60-day multiple entry
- Transit Visa (Dubai only) – 48-hour single entry
- Transit Visa (Dubai only) – 96-hour single entry
Selecting the correct visa type before applying can help ensure your travel plans match your authorized length of stay.
Prepare the required documents
Most applications require supporting documents such as:
- A scanned copy of your passport's biographical page
- A recent passport-sized photograph
- Flight itinerary
- Hotel booking or accommodation details
- Additional documents, if requested
After uploading your documents, pay the applicable visa fee using one of the accepted online payment methods. Once your application is submitted, you'll receive a confirmation email and a reference number to track its status.
